The Wiener filter represents the optimum linear filter in the Mean-Square Error (MSE) sense for stationary inputs. Haykin uses the Wiener filter as a theoretical benchmark. All adaptive algorithms aim to converge toward this optimum solution, known as the Wiener solution. 3. Linear Prediction
